#f11850 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f11850 is composed of 94.5% red, 9.4%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90% magenta, 66.8%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 344.5 degrees, a saturation of 88.6% and a lightness of 52%. #f11850 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ff30a0 with #e30000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

Shades and Tints of #f11850

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090103 is the darkest color, while #fef6f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f11850

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#898082 is the less saturated color, while #fa0f4b is the most saturated one.
